APA certification is a valuable, objective credential that verifies a specified level of knowledge, skills, and abilities in the payroll profession. Certification helps individuals demonstrate their payroll expertise, secure promotions, advance their careers, and enhance their standing within the profession.

APA offers two levels of certification -- the Fundamental Payroll Certification (FPC) and the Certified Payroll Professional (CPP).

Fundamental Payroll Certification (FPC) -- The FPC is a certification credential for payroll beginners and service and support professionals with payroll knowledge. There are no payroll experience requirements to take this exam.

Certified Payroll Professional (CPP) -- The CPP is a certification credential for those with payroll knowledge and experience.
